Graham's issue is mainly with the timing that they have to make a decision before the new cars have actually been really bedded in performance wise (bearing in mind that once the car has been homologated, there is no development for three years - only for obvious design flaws with regards reliability and safety - that was why for instance Strakka didn't race last year)
Something has to happen about the current situation. Last year there was a proposal about doing away with the 'silver' or 'bronze' requirement - but that was not popular.
